Congratulating TAIP Co-Applicant and CRDCN Executive Director, Dr. Natalie Harrower!
Dr. Natalie Harrower, TAIP co-applicant and Executive Director of the Canadian Research Data Centre Network (CRDCN) has been awarded funding from the Digital Research Alliance of Canada to develop a national data space for researchers who work with sensitive social science data. CRDCN is Canada’s largest national research infrastructure serving social science researchers and this opportunity signifies a meaningful boost for the social sciences!
